Text
The secretary may from time to time, upon first giving the applicant or licensee an opportunity for a hearing on the matter, (1) deny any application for a license, (2) refuse to renew any license, (3) suspend any license for a time or upon a condition having a reasonable relation to the administration of the provisions of sections 71-3201 to 71-3213 , or (4) revoke any license issued or renewed under the provisions of sections 71-3201 to 71-3213 (a) upon a determination that there has been a significant change in those individuals participating directly in the management of the applicant's or licensee's business in the State of Nebraska or that, (b) by reason of such applicant's or licensee's failure to comply with the provisions of sections 71-3201 to 71-3213 , insolvency, bank
